Our school is a small, rural school with approximately 450 students in pre-k through eighth grade. They live in an area of high poverty. Approximately seventy-five percent of our students qualify for free or reduced lunch. Forty-eight percent of these students speak English as a second language. Every year we have students come to school without any English at all. Their families are supportive but have language deficits as well. As a school, we try to provide as many opportunities for our students to be successful in and out of the classroom. We have begun a soccer team but are unable to get funding for even the basics our boys need.
These boys are eager to learn the game of soccer and improve their skills, despite having many challenges to overcome.
Soccer gives them the opportunity to be part of something bigger than themselves. They have the chance to be a part of a team, to set goals and work together to accomplish them. These are important life skills that will never be forgotten. Purchasing the equipment necessary to support the team will help our team and school community as well.
My Project
Our new soccer team is eager to learn and improve their soccer skills for the upcoming season. The passing gates will be used to develop accuracy and ball control. We will add the bright targets and balls into soccer practice warm-up drills to improve players’ agility, footwork, and dribbling techniques and watch in-game passing and foot skills improve.
The 3-in-1 Soccer Trainer will be used in a variety of training experiences.
We can practice goals, shot targets, and rebounds to develop players’ shooting accuracy and control in the box.
We are excited to watch our boys grow together as a team.
